Unilever to cut jobs across all regions

Unilever PLC plans to slash thousands of management positions across its operations, a source familiar with the matter said on Monday.

The job cuts will be in the “low thousands“, the person said.

The development comes on the heels of reports that activist investor Nelson Peltz’s hedge fund, Trian Partners, is building an unspecified stake in the consumer goods giant whose strategy is under scrutiny after a short-lived pursuit of GSK’s consumer healthcare arm.

Bloomberg first reported the news on Unilever’s plans to cut jobs. The move would eliminate numerous regional and divisional roles that Chief Executive Officer Alan Jope is said to believe have slowed innovation.

The company employs about 150,000 globally.
